DO912 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: DO - Dictionary: Mass activation of domains and data elements

  • Message number: 912

  • Message text: Copy & of DDFTX was activated

    The SAP error message DO912, which states "Copy & of DDFTX was activated," typically relates to issues with the Data Dictionary or the transport of objects in SAP. This message often indicates that there is a problem with the activation of a data element or a domain, particularly when it comes to copying or transporting data dictionary objects.
    
    Cause: Transport Issues: The error may occur if there are inconsistencies in the transport requests or if the objects are not properly included in the transport. Activation Problems: The data dictionary object (like a domain or data element) may not have been activated correctly, leading to issues when trying to copy or use it. Dependencies: There may be dependencies on other objects that have not been activated or are in an inconsistent state. Version Conflicts: If there are multiple versions of the same object, it can lead to conflicts during activation.
